Hazardous Waste Regulations (and business waste)

This Section deals with the Hazardous Waste (England and Wales) Regulations 2005 and business waste in England, Northern Ireland and Wales.

Hazardous waste is generated in one form or another by most businesses and includes items such as fluorescent tubes, computer monitors as well as more obvious materials such as solvents and chemicals. The EWC provides a full list of hazardous and non-hazardous wastes.
Premises must be registered with the Environment Agency before hazardous waste leaves the site. However, some premises will be exempt if:

  • a premises produces less than 200kg of hazardous waste in any 12-month period
  • the premises is an office, a shop, used for the collection of waste electrical and electronic equipment, or a dental, veterinary or medical practice
  • the premises use a registered carrier (or one exempt from being registered) to remove hazardous waste from where it was produced.

If the premises are not exempt, it must register, even if it produces less than 200kg of hazardous waste in any 12 month period.

If a premises is a farm it does not need to register unless it produces more than 500kg per year. This limit is likely to be reviewed and farm premises should be aware this figure may alter in the future. All hazardous waste must be transferred using the consignment note system, visit the relevant section of the Haz Guide.
